 Sunday was rainy pretty much all day- boo! We decided to drive down to Seaside to check out the town. I had heard Seaside was a neat place, but, again, we were blown away. Imagine the perfect, little beach town with beautiful homes, food stands on the corners, artist shops everywhere, kids riding bikes- that's Seaside. If you remember The Truman Show, that movie was filmed in Seaside and that's pretty much the way it is. It was so fun just walking around, checking it all out.
